Description

Some homes tick boxes; 3 Verdun Road sweeps them. From the moment you see it lit against a Yorkshire sunset — mellow stone, characterful leaded bay windows, a classic storm porch — you can tell this is a home finished with genuine care and a real sense of style. Set on one of Wibsey's most sought-after roads, it's a fully extended four-bedroom family home renovated to an exceptional standard throughout, with quite possibly the best entertaining garden you'll find at this level.

Step inside and the quality is immediate: warm herringbone flooring in the hall, elegant glazed oak doors and a staircase dressed in soft damask paper. To the front are two generous reception rooms, each with its own personality — one a showpiece with a striking blue feature wallpaper, herringbone flooring and a leaded bay window; the other, in a pretty botanical paper with its own bay, making the perfect snug or family room.

But it's the rear that truly steals the show. The extension has created a simply stunning open-plan kitchen, dining and family space running the full width of the home. The kitchen is beautifully appointed — soft grey shaker cabinetry, crisp white quartz worktops, a peninsula breakfast bar and integrated appliances — while twin rooflights flood the room with light and a full wall of bi-fold doors folds right back to bring the garden inside. A separate laundry keeps the everyday tidied away.

Upstairs, four well-proportioned bedrooms — several finished with bold designer feature walls — are joined by a dedicated home office and, at its heart, a genuinely luxurious family bathroom with a walk-in rainfall shower, a stylish bath, feature mosaic detailing and a floating vanity. It's a spa-like finish you rarely see in a family home.

And then there's the garden — an entertainer's dream. Beyond the full-width Indian stone patio and lawn sits a smart covered seating area, a hot tub, and the real showpiece: a superb detached garden room, currently fitted out as a fantastic bar and social space with its own decked terrace — the ultimate spot for summer evenings and match days. Better still, planning permission has been granted to create a self-contained annex, so the potential for multi-generational living, guests or an income is there whenever you want it. A gated driveway offers ample parking, with a detached garage beyond.

You're superbly placed in Wibsey, within easy reach of three 'Good'-rated primary schools — St Paul's, St Winefride's and Farfield — and the 'Outstanding'-rated Eternal Light, with local shops close by and quick access across Bradford and toward the M606.

Here are the top 7 things you need to know when moving home:

Get your house valued by 3 different agents before you put it on the market

Don't pick the agent that values it the highest, without evidence of other properties sold in the same area

It's always best to put your house on the market before you find a property

The estate agent acts for the seller and is there to get the seller the best price possible

Understand the length of time it can take - 14 weeks from when you accept an offer, or have an offer accepted to move in! A long time!

It can get stressful, but speak to your agent and your solicitor and they will put you in the picture
